    Built in the late 19th century, this historic railway station is a testament to the architectural brilliance of its time, with its grand arched windows, intricate ironwork, and imposing clock tower standing tall against the skyline.
    Every Sunday from 7 am till 14, Dworzec Świebodzki transforms into a bustling flea market, where the echoes of history mingle with the vibrant energy of commerce. Venture onto the train tracks, and you'll find yourself surrounded by a kaleidoscope of stalls and vendors, each offering a treasure trove of vintage goods, antiques, and handmade crafts.
    From retro furniture to quirky collectibles, there's something for everyone at Dworzec Świebodzki's Sunday flea market. Explore row after row of stalls, haggle with friendly vendors, and uncover hidden gems that tell their own unique stories.
